  • Abstract
    This paper considers the problem of balanced model reduction for a class of distributed parameter systems. The system is assumed to have a finite-dimensional state vector as well as a finite dimensional input vector. However, the output is allowed to be of infinite dimension. This often occurs in the modelling of physical systems such as flexible structures, acoustic duets, etc. It is shown that a reduced model based on balanced truncation guarantees an upper bound on the H norm of the error system
